Simulation of the Microbunching Instability in Beam Delivery Systems for Free Electron Lasers

Description

In this paper, we examine the growth of the microbunching instability in the electron beam delivery system of a free electron laser (FEL). We present the results of two sets of simulations, one conducted using a direct Vlasov solver, the other using a particle-in-cell code Impact-Z with the number of simulation macroparticles ranging up to 100 million. Discussion is focused on the details of longitudinal dynamics and on numerical values of uncorrelated (slice) energy spread at different points in the lattice. In particular, we assess the efficacy of laser heater in suppression of the instability, and look at the interplay between physical and numerical noise in particle-based simulations
